Please excuse my half-knowledge. I confess, I never really used Gentoo. I always thought there is only a software repository and a package management with some presets (If you don't like to compile everything manually), but your machine still has to compile everything itself.
However, Once I tried Sabayon (an already properly set up Gentoo derivate) and almost everything was buggy there.
So I hope you're right and there will be a way around those missconfigurations (so that everything works out of the box).
When i tried Sabayon, i tried not to pick out my eyes with a fondue fork, when i saw their software management system.
Sabayon is based on Gentoo, but almost nothing is left from Gentoo in there.
And its really damn buggy. Very much.
Sabayon doesnt even properly support Portage. They burried it inside the system and forgot bout it
I don't think Gentoo will get ANY speed improvement.
The advantage of Gentoo is, that you can optimize the binary for every system, which is quite practical for PCs, where every system looks different.
But there will be only one specific pyra hardware.
Look at the pandora: All emulators are optimized for THIS system just like gentoo would do it. But I don't have to build Drastic on my own, I can just download a binary.
Furthermore ED already mentioned a pyra specific repository for some pyra related packages. Some time-critical libraries could be replaced with optimized ones. But 90% of the libraries are not time-critical and we don't need to build them on our own...
And you really think to compile stuff in "just one night" is user friendly?
An user wants to download and play, not download, compile... and play tomorrow.
Ok. You are talking about hardware optimizations, and assume that Pyra team will have time to recompile the entire Debian repo for Pyra.
Ok, we got one version of hardware (which will be wrong as soon as ED releases different CPU cards).
Yet, there are 2 more optimizations: USE flags, and just pure ricing flags.
Some people would prefer to safe memory, battery and etc by removing unneeded features.
Some people, would prefer to go ricing, and explore "what else they can add to CFLAGS".
1 night, is for my "i forgot how much" years old PDA, and for the entire desktop environment.
On a Pyra, the entire DE, from "clean stage3" would be much less. Maybe 1-2 hour. How much does it take on Debian? Much i guess.
And for a simple emulator, it would be just a matter of few minutes. (Or less)
Also, i stated that because the XFCE(Or whatever ED plans), FireFox and some other software will be already there, beats the need for all what i mentioned above.
You will barely notice the difference in speed. After all, we have a serious experience of compiling software from the source.
My vote goes towards arch. As others have said, I've been using it for a while, and the only time I ever have a problem is when I try and experiment with my tower
Also some other advantages to it (IMO), are:
The way it manages package
It's lightweight and fast
The Archwiki
Easy to work with
If we were to go with arch though, we obviously couldn't have the default be the pure, GUIless, arch. we'd have to customize it, but keeping a "pure" arch distro for those who want it would be nice.
If we can't(won't) go with arch, debian is fine too.
Who let the
dogs #archlinux out?
I tried to learn "how", but i failed.
Gentoo is also light. And no one can argue bout the speed. How small can you Arch get?
Ok, ArchWiki wins at the points of "Change color of that exact pixel in KDE".
Arch didnt even let me get past the installation. Me! A experienced Gentoo user!
Doesnt that defeats you so loved "K.I.S.S"? I am not saying to put plain CLI Gentoo there either, i even want it to be distributed with pre-installed emulators for unexperienced users, and i also want (and will anyway install) pure Gentoo there after getting mine. (With LXDE and hookers)